I went to the Sen. Merkley town hall meeting in Madras this afternoon. You've seen the clips of the Birthers totally destroying some poor Congressman's meeting back east? Well, right-wingers/evangelicals tried it at Merkley's meeting. The place was packed -- maybe 300 people. And when the meeting got going it was clear they had one agenda -- to disrupt the meeting as much as possible.
They wanted to talk about immigration (seal the borders, shoot them as they come across), health care (euthanasia for old people -- isn't this fascism?, why do illegal immigrants get health care?). They booed loudly questions about global warming (chanted "drill, baby, drill"), alternative energy (just drill), and ending the wars. "I'm a good Christian, and I'm not going to allow this in my country." These people are crazed, and they're here in Central Oregon!
Merkley did an excellent job of handling them and keeping them toned down. Apparently most of the town meetings he has held are this way. One lady spent nearly 10 minutes quoting 2 to 4 word snippets out of the current house bill to prove it required rationing health care, euthanizing old people, and providing health care to illegal immigrants. Merkley pointed out at the end of her diatribe that he had read the bill, and the bill does not say what she has been led to believe it says if you actually read whole sentences or paragraphs.
